SQLite 优势

SQLite 优点

SQLite 是一个非常流行的数据库,它已成功地与磁盘文件格式一起用于桌面应用程序,如版本控制系统、财务分析工具、媒体编目和编辑套件、CAD 包、记录保存程序等。

使用 SQLite 作为应用程序文件格式有很多优点:

1) 轻量化

  • SQLite 是一个非常轻量级的数据库,因此很容易将它用作电视、手机、相机、家用电子设备等设备的嵌入式软件。

2) 性能优秀

  • SQLite 数据库的读写操作非常快。它比文件系统快近 35%。
  • 它只加载需要的数据,而不是读取整个文件并将其保存在内存中。
  • 如果您编辑小部分,它只会覆盖文件中已更改的部分。

3) 免安装

  • SQLite 非常容易学习。您不需要安装和配置它。只需在您的计算机上下载 SQLite 库,即可创建数据库。

4) 高可用

  • 它会不断更新您的内容,因此在断电或崩溃的情况下,很少或不会丢失任何工作。
  • SQLite 比自定义编写的文件 I/O 代码更不容易出错。
  • SQLite 查询比等效的过程代码更小,因此出现错误的可能性很小。

5) 移植性好

  • SQLite 可移植到所有 32 位和 64 位操作系统以及大端和小端架构。
  • 多个进程可以附加同一个应用程序文件,并且可以互不干扰地读写。
  • 它可以与所有编程语言一起使用,没有任何兼容性问题。

6) 无障碍

  • SQLite 数据库可通过多种第三方工具访问。
  • 如果 SQLite 数据库的内容丢失,则更有可能恢复。数据比代码寿命更长。

7) 降低成本和复杂性

  • 它降低了应用程序成本,因为可以使用简洁的 SQL 查询而不是冗长且容易出错的过程查询来访问和更新内容。
  • 只需添加新表和/或列,SQLite 就可以在未来的版本中轻松扩展。它还保留了向后兼容性。

SQLite 缺点

  • SQLite 用于处理低到中等流量的 HTTP 请求。
  • 在大多数情况下,数据库大小限制为 2GB。

热门文章

优秀文章